Alex Turner - A Musical Journey

Early Life and Influences

Alex Turner, born on January 6, 1986, in Sheffield, England, displayed a passion for music from a young age. His early influences included classic rock bands like The Beatles and The Rolling Stones, as well as contemporary artists such as The Libertines and The Strokes.

The Arctic Monkeys

In 2002, Turner formed the Arctic Monkeys with schoolmates Jamie Cook, Matt Helders, and Andy Nicholson. The band quickly gained recognition for their raw and energetic live performances, and their debut album, "Whatever People Say I Am, That's What I'm Not," became the fastest-selling debut album in British history upon its release in 2006.

Musical Style and Evolution

Turner's songwriting is characterized by its clever lyrics, often laced with witty and observational humor. The Arctic Monkeys' music has evolved over the years, from the garage rock of their early albums to the more experimental and psychedelic sounds of their later work.

Collaborations and Side Projects

Beyond his work with the Arctic Monkeys, Turner has collaborated with various artists, including Miles Kane, Richard Hawley, and Iggy Pop. He also formed the side project The Last Shadow Puppets with Kane in 2008, which has released two critically acclaimed albums.

Personal Life and Impact

Turner is known for his private personal life, rarely giving interviews or making public appearances outside of his musical endeavors. His lyrics and music have resonated with countless fans, making him one of the most influential musicians of his generation.

Awards and Recognition

The Arctic Monkeys have won numerous awards, including seven Brit Awards and two Grammy Awards. Turner has also been recognized for his songwriting, winning the Ivor Novello Award for Best Contemporary Song for "Do I Wanna Know?" in 2014.

Conclusion

Alex Turner's unique songwriting and musical vision have made him one of the most iconic figures in contemporary rock music. His impact on the industry and the lives of music lovers worldwide continues to grow with each new release.
